Friends of Simon Wiesenthal Center Deplores Antisemitic Propaganda and Incitement to Violent Conflict in Toronto Arabic Newspaper

ID: 1182952

"The unyielding fortitude and victory that Gaza achieved would not have materialized without the unconstrained help of Iran, Syria and Hezbollah, who provided weaponry, rockets, training and financing. . ." - Translated excerpt of a column by 'Meshwar' editor Dr. Nazih Khataba in the November 30 issues of the Toronto newspaper

(firmenpresse) - TORONTO, ONTARIO -- (Marketwire) -- 12/21/12 -- Friends of Simon Wiesenthal Center for Holocaust Studies (FSWC) deplores the blatant antisemitism and unashamed cheering for the brutal regimes of Iran and Syria and the terror group Hezbollah by a Toronto Arabic newspaper. Dr. Nazih Khataba, the editor of 'Meshwar' and author of the column advocating the destruction of Israel and the promotion of Nazi-like antisemitic stereotypes, is also a board member of Palestine House.

"We are horrified, saddened and alarmed by the antisemitic hate dripping from this column and the three cartoons depicting Jews in a manner that could only have been inspired by a reverence for Hitler and the Final Solution," explained FSWC President and CEO Avi Benlolo. "We are stunned that this filthy propaganda is being freely promoted to Toronto's Arabic speaking population and will be following up with the police regarding the overt hatred and incitement to violence in this column," he added.
